Franco Franco Abbina / Franco Abbiana
Rome, 31 March 1934
Franco Abbina, of Spanish origin, before turning to acting he devoted himself to the study of Economics and music, in 1970 he participates in the General Dispute film directed by Luigi Zampa. In the early seventies he devoted himself to painting and simultaneously illustrations for a book of poetry of Alda Merini.Participates in a dozen movies directed by Federico Fellini, Vittorio De Sica, Luigi Magni, Mauro Bolognini, Luigi Zampa.
He collaborated with production designer Emanuele Luzzati.
